Types of Glass for Replacement
When considering glass replacement, it's crucial to acknowledge the various types offered. Each type serves special purposes and visual choices.
Table of Glass Types
Glass Type
Description
Typical Uses
Tempered Glass
Heat-treated for strength; shatters into little pieces.
Shower doors, glass doors, windows.
Laminated Glass
Layers of glass and plastic for effect resistance.
Skylights, soundproof windows, automobiles.
Insulated Glass
2 or more panes with a gas fill for energy effectiveness.
Residential windows, commercial buildings.
Low-E Glass
Coated to show heat; improves energy effectiveness.
Windows, skylights for environment control.
Annealed Glass
Basic glass that is not heat-treated; less durable.
Ornamental applications, basic windows.

Cost of Glass Replacement
The expense of glass replacement can differ significantly based on numerous aspects. Here's a breakdown of typical expenses:
Cost Factors
Element
Description
Type of Glass
Specialized types like low-E or insulated glass can be more expensive.
Size and Area
Larger or custom pieces will increase cost.
Availability
Hard-to-reach areas might need additional labor.
Labor Costs
Costs can vary by region and the complexity of installation.
Average Pricing Estimates
Glass Type
Average Cost per Square Foot
Tempered Glass
₤ 25 – ₤ 75
Laminated Glass
₤ 30 – ₤ 90
Insulated Glass
₤ 50 – ₤ 100
Low-E Glass
₤ 55 – ₤ 120
Annealed Glass
₤ 10 – ₤ 25
FAQ Section
1. For how long does glass replacement take?
Most glass replacement jobs can be finished within a few hours to a day, depending upon the size and complexity.
2. Can I change glass myself?
While DIY glass replacement is possible, it's advisable to work with specialists for safety factors and to guarantee correct installation.
3. What should I do if my glass is broken?
If glass is broken, it's vital to get in touch with a professional instantly to prevent more damage and guarantee security.
4. Is insurance most likely to cover glass replacement?
Numerous homeowners' insurance plan cover glass replacement, specifically if it results from a covered hazard. Constantly examine your policy.
5. What is double-glazing?
Double-glazing describes a window system made with two glass panes separated by a space to enhance insulation and energy performance.
